Output 743df10355c966cf9d12486fd79eeb6d7a53e16703c9ae49acadb62d8310e698:3

value
22620330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 765a60c06531deb104024c3c737f26771bc42c3c OP_EQUAL
address
3CUovkPEZgSb9NGH3PMhaPAk2Ead13ZL1F
transaction
743df10355c966cf9d12486fd79eeb6d7a53e16703c9ae49acadb62d8310e698
confirmations
297794
spent
true